About Future Advocacy
Based in London, United Kingdom, with a secondary office in Brussels, Future Advocacy operates at the intersection of policy, communications, and social change. London’s competitive public affairs landscape is dense with agencies serving corporate and political clients, but Future Advocacy has carved out a distinct niche by focusing exclusively on non-partisan advocacy for global betterment. The agency’s location in the Islington area of London places it close to both UK political networks and the international development community, while its Brussels presence allows it to engage with European Union policymaking. This dual-base structure reflects the cross-border nature of the issues it tackles, from climate change to artificial intelligence governance.
What Future Advocacy Does
Future Advocacy positions itself as a non-partisan advocacy and consultancy agency that helps clients turn their assets into actionable influence. Rather than offering generic PR services, the agency specializes in designing and executing campaigns that shift policy, public opinion, and behavior. Its approach is grounded in strategic communications, research, and mobilization, often combining digital campaigning with traditional media relations. The agency also houses the Future Advocacy Lab, a dedicated unit that explores emerging policy challenges—such as the societal implications of AI—and develops forward-looking strategies. This lab functions as an internal think tank, producing reports and frameworks that inform both client work and broader public debate.

Clients and Sectors
Future Advocacy works primarily with nonprofit organizations, think tanks, and foundations, though it also consults for select corporate clients on issues like sustainability. Its portfolio spans food and nutrition, health, children’s rights, international development, democracy and governance, and technology policy. For example, the agency has supported initiatives aimed at improving global nutrition standards, advancing children’s digital rights, and shaping European AI regulations.
